A series of high severity vulnerabilities have been reported in Chromium and its embeddable version, CEF. Key issues include inappropriate implementations and out-of-bounds writes affecting various components, with CVEs such as CVE-2025-13042, CVE-2025-12725, and CVE-2025-12036 identified. Users are advised to update to the latest versions to mitigate these risks.
